Varenna offers a variety of museums and landmarks to choose from. Most people visit the town for its beautiful setting on Lake Como. There are some popular sights around town though such as the Church of San Giorgio and Castello di Vezio.

Biarritz offers a handful of options for museums and historical sights. Most people pass their time relaxing on the beach or taking a walk, but you can also visit the Biarritz Aquarium or the Biarritz Lighthouse.

Dining out in Biarritz is an experience not to be missed. The food is a delicious mix of French, Spanish, and Basque flavors. Seafood is an obvious influence, but you'll also find meat and bread in many dishes. Local specialties include the oysters, pintxos (a snack of bread topped with ham, cheese, or vegetables), and marmitako (tuna stew).

Biarritz has a lively atmosphere and nightlife is popular here. The city center has the most bars and clubs if you're looking for a party. Head to Port Vieux or Les Halles for some of the city's best nightlife. For a more relaxed night out, there are night markets as well as beach front terraces and rooftops where you can sip wine in a mellow atmosphere.

Varenna is generally a quiet destination but there are options around. The best way to enjoy the evening is to head to a restaurant and spend the time sipping wine in a laid back setting.

Many people visit Biarritz for it's beautiful beaches. There are plenty of sandy beaches near the town that offer great surfing. For calmer water you can head to some of the smaller bays. Some of the most popular beaches in the area include Le Grande Plage, Plage du Miramar, and Plage Port Vieux.

Many visitors explore the nearby hiking trails while visiting Varenna. There are lakefront trails and other hiking options near town. The Lungolago di Varenna - Baia di Varenna loop follows the water and makes for a pleasant stroll.

Biarritz is well-known for its shopping. The town has many market halls, boutiques, and department stores. Head to Avenue de Verdun for some quirky local stores or Place Georges Clemenceau for more high end shopping.

Many visitors go to Varenna to go shopping. The streets are lined with artisan shops and boutique venders that are fun to explore.

Which place is cheaper, Varenna or Biarritz?

These are the overall average travel costs for the two destinations.

The average daily cost (per person) in Biarritz is €131, while the average daily cost in Varenna is €164. These costs include accommodation (assuming double occupancy, so the traveler is sharing the room), food, transportation, and entertainment. While every person is different, these costs are an average of past travelers in each destination. What follows is a categorical breakdown of travel costs for Biarritz and Varenna in more detail.

When is the best time to visit Biarritz or Varenna?

Both destinations experience a temperate climate with four distinct seasons. And since both cities are in the northern hemisphere, summer is in July and winter is in January.

Biarritz is cooler than Varenna in the summer. The daily temperature in Biarritz averages around 20°C (68°F) in July, and Varenna fluctuates around 23°C (73°F).

It's quite sunny in Varenna. The sun comes out a lot this time of the year in Biarritz. Biarritz usually receives less sunshine than Varenna during summer. Biarritz gets 209 hours of sunny skies, while Varenna receives 250 hours of full sun in the summer.

It rains a lot this time of the year in Varenna. In July, Biarritz usually receives less rain than Varenna. Biarritz gets 81 mm (3.2 in) of rain, while Varenna receives 133 mm (5.2 in) of rain each month for the summer.

Typical Weather for Varenna and Biarritz

Biarritz Varenna
Temp (°C) Rain (mm) Temp (°C) Rain (mm)
Jan 8°C (47°F) 183 mm (7.2 in) 5°C (41°F) 76 mm (3 in)
Feb 9°C (49°F) 147 mm (5.8 in) 6°C (44°F) 71 mm (2.8 in)
Mar 10°C (51°F) 148 mm (5.8 in) 10°C (49°F) 106 mm (4.2 in)
Apr 12°C (54°F) 163 mm (6.4 in) 13°C (55°F) 152 mm (6 in)
May 15°C (59°F) 139 mm (5.5 in) 17°C (62°F) 194 mm (7.6 in)
Jun 18°C (64°F) 92 mm (3.6 in) 20°C (69°F) 171 mm (6.7 in)
Jul 20°C (68°F) 81 mm (3.2 in) 23°C (73°F) 133 mm (5.2 in)
Aug 20°C (68°F) 115 mm (4.5 in) 22°C (72°F) 166 mm (6.5 in)
Sep 18°C (65°F) 134 mm (5.3 in) 19°C (67°F) 153 mm (6 in)
Oct 16°C (60°F) 155 mm (6.1 in) 15°C (58°F) 140 mm (5.5 in)
Nov 11°C (52°F) 190 mm (7.5 in) 9°C (49°F) 120 mm (4.7 in)
Dec 9°C (49°F) 184 mm (7.2 in) 6°C (42°F) 63 mm (2.5 in)
